International Journal of Progressive Mathematics Education
ISSN : 27762726     EISSN : 27758435     DOI : https://doi.org/10.22236/ijopme
Core Subject : Science, Education,
nternational Journal of Progressive Mathematics Education E-ISSN:2775-8435, ISSN: 2776-2726, DOI Prefix 10.22236/ijopme is a peer-revieweopen-access international journal that aims to the sharing, dissemination, and discussion of current trends research results, experience, and perspectives across a wide range of mathematics education, teaching mathematics, development in mathematics instruction, innovations in mathematics learning, and current trends issue in mathematics education research. This journal will be published four-issue per year in March, June, September, and December published by the UHAMKA Press. Given that the journal prioritizes research reports in mathematics education, viewpoint articles in the same field will be considered for publication. International Journal of Progressive Mathematics Education welcomes research articles, literature reviews, book reviews from various countries in the world that have high-quality on all topics related to current trends issue in mathematics education research to publish in this journal. Submitted papers must be written in English dan Bahasa Indonesia for the initial review stage by editors and further review process by international reviewer

Abstract

The low level of student independence in geometry requires a paradigm shift in evaluation that actively involves students. This research aims to produce a learning tool for Flat-Sided Solid Geometry based on Assessment as learning  (AaL) that has been tested for validity, practicality, and effectiveness. This development research used a 4-D model limited to the Define, Design, and Develop stages, with 24 students from SMPN 6 Topoyo as its pilot subjects. The results showed that the developed product, consisting of lesson plans (RPP), student worksheets (LKPD), and assessment instruments (self- and peer-assessment), met high validity criteria. Field trials demonstrated the tool's practicality and effectiveness in improving learning outcomes and positive student responses. This research contributes significantly to providing learning tools that train metacognitive skills and self-regulated learning, while transforming students' roles into independent assessors in mathematics learning.   Rendahnya kemandirian siswa dalam materi geometri menuntut pergeseran paradigma evaluasi yang melibatkan siswa secara aktif.
